
The Swirling and Whirling Waterpot
Cross-Cultural Step of Rhythm and Grace
Experience the swirling artistry of the WaterPot, a signature FatChanceBellyDance® Volume 7 movement created by Megha Gavin. Belonging to the Rhythmic Undulation (Arabic) family, the WaterPot is a fast vocabulary move that beautifully expresses the cross-cultural fusion at the heart of FCBD® Style—blending aspects from Egyptian and Indian dance traditions.

Fascinated by the arts as a child, Nivetha began studying Belly dance 12 years ago, training under several renowned teachers across the world. During her training in Belly dance and Yoga, she discovered and fell deeply in love with Tribal Fusion Belly dance.
With certifications in Dancecraft - Key of Diamonds by Zoe Jakes and Krysalis - Invocation by Kami Liddle, as well as being a Level 2 Yoga practitioner certified by the Yoga Certification Board, Government of India, she has been exploring and building her style by mindfully fusing nuances from the diverse dance forms she is proficient in, while keeping Belly dance as the foundation. She is also a certified FCBD®️ - Teacher and takes pride in being the first certified and officially recognised FCBD®️ Sister Studio in India.
As a solo artist and the director of Saara - The Bellydance Space, she has showcased her creative explorations on renowned dance platforms. Her teaching journey began in 2015, eventually inspiring her to establish Saara - The Bellydance Space, where her vision of a structured and supportive environment empowers beginner and intermediate dancers to grow confidently and explore self-expression. Her holistic approach fosters a deep connection between body and mind, inviting her students to truly fall in love with the art of Belly dance.
In addition to her regular certified classes in Bangalore, she has conducted workshops and performed at various belly dance festivals nationwide. In recent years, she has had the opportunity to bring her dance programs to Europe, the UK, and Australia, expanding her reach to the international Belly dance community and sharing her artistry worldwide.
